Breast Most cancers Cryoablation
Overview

Cryoablation is emerging as a promising cure for breast cancer, specially for modest tumors. It includes the usage of extreme cold (liquid nitrogen or argon gasoline) to freeze and destroy cancerous tissues. This technique is minimally invasive, carried out under imaging steering (typically ultrasound), and will be an alternative choice to surgical treatment for picked sufferers.

Advantages

Minimally Invasive: Preserves encompassing healthy tissues and lessens publish-operative difficulties.

Fast Recovery: Ordinarily allows for speedier Restoration in comparison with common surgical treatment.

Outpatient Course of action: Frequently done being an outpatient procedure, minimizing clinic stays.

Varicose Vein Cure with Laser
Overview

Laser treatment (Endovenous Laser Ablation or EVLA) is actually a minimally invasive technique used to treat varicose veins. A laser fiber is inserted into the vein under ultrasound advice, providing laser Strength that heats and seals the vein shut. This closes from the defective vein, redirecting blood stream to much healthier veins.

Gains

Non-Surgical: No need for incisions; process performed through a little puncture.

Higher Good results Fee: Powerful in dealing with varicose veins and strengthening signs or symptoms.

Small Scarring: Leaves small to no scarring when compared to regular vein stripping operation.

Ultrasound-Guided Biopsy
Overview

Ultrasound-guided biopsy can be a diagnostic procedure employed to get tissue samples from suspicious areas recognized on ultrasound imaging. A biopsy needle is guided by authentic-time ultrasound images to target the exact spot of issue, ensuring accurate sampling for pathological Examination.

Added benefits

Precision: Provides precise targeting of suspicious places, strengthening diagnostic precision.

Minimally Invasive: Avoids the necessity For additional invasive treatments for tissue sampling.

Immediate Results: Enables rapid pathology outcomes, facilitating timely therapy organizing.
